an empty string IS a NULL. There is no difference at all.
I think the point is you can not select the data using, e.g.WHERE colname = ''.
So how do you represent unknown values? By using a default "UNKNOWN"?
Sometimes you know what the value is, and it's blank. There's just too many ways to look at it.
